CVE-2021-38563: An issue was discovered in Foxit PDF Reader before 11.0.1 and PDF Editor before 11.0.1.

An issue was discovered in Foxit PDF Reader before 11.0.1 and PDF Editor before 11.0.1. It mishandles situations in which an array size (derived from a /Size entry) is smaller than the maximum indirect object number, and thus there is an attempted incorrect array access (leading to a NULL pointer dereference, or out-of-bounds read or write).

Technical view

The issue involves an array size derived from a PDF /Size entry being smaller than the maximum indirect object number. Foxit then attempts incorrect array access, leading to NULL pointer dereference, out-of-bounds read, or out-of-bounds write in affected Reader and Editor versions before 11.0.1.

Mitigation direction

  • Inventory Foxit PDF Reader and PDF Editor installations across managed endpoints.
  • Update affected Foxit installations to 11.0.1 or later, following Foxit guidance.
  • Prioritize users who open external PDFs or handle customer-supplied documents.
  • Restrict untrusted PDF handling where updates cannot be completed promptly.
